面对Centos8停止服务,使用yum源安装时出现“错误:「Failed to download metadata for repo ‘AppStream’: Cannot prepare internal mirrorlist: No URLs in mirrorlist」”的问题,我们可以通过以下步骤解决:第一步,进入yum的repos目录。通过命令cd /etc/yum.repos.d/,定位到存放所有yum源配置的目录...
面对Centos8停止服务,使用yum源安装时出现“错误:「Failed to download metadata for repo ‘AppStream’: Cannot prepare internal mirrorlist: No URLs in mirrorlist」”的问题,我们可以通过以下步骤解决:
第一步,进入yum的repos目录。通过命令cd /etc/yum.repos.d/,定位到存放所有yum源配置的目录。
第二步,修改所有的CentOS文件内容。需要重点修改与CentOS相关的repo文件,如CentOS.repo等。修改时,删除或注释掉所有与CentOS相关的源地址,确保只保留第三方或替代源的配置。
第三步,更新yum源为阿里镜像。访问阿里云官方提供的Centos源地址,如`
https://mirrors.aliyun.com/centos/`,复制最新的yum源配置文件内容。将文件内容粘贴到修改后的repo文件中,替换原有的源地址。确保文件内容完整、无误。
第四步,完成修改后,重启yum服务以应用更改。使用命令`systemctl restart yum`进行重启。重启后,yum服务将使用新配置的源进行更新。
最后一步,进行yum安装测试。打开终端,尝试执行简单的yum安装命令,如`yum install `,以验证是否可以正常安装所需软件包。如果操作顺利,说明yum源已成功更新并启用。
按照上述步骤操作后,您将能够正常使用yum进行软件安装,解决Centos8使用yum源安装时遇到的问题。2024-11-09